SUSE Linux 12-SP5: 2021:3528-1 Important Java Patch for Security Issues

An update that fixes 10 vulnerabilities is now available. . SUSE Security Update: Security update for java-11-openjdk ______________________________________________________________________________ Announcement ID: SUSE-SU-2021:3528-1 Rating: important References: #1191901 #1191903 #1191904 #1191906 #1191909 #1191910 #1191911 #1191912 #1191913 #1191914 Cross-References: CVE-2021-35550 CVE-2021-35556 CVE-2021-35559 CVE-2021-35561 CVE-2021-35564 CVE-2021-35565 CVE-2021-35567 CVE-2021-35578 CVE-2021-35586 CVE-2021-35603 CVSS scores: CVE-2021-35550 (NVD) : 5.9 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:H/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:N/A:N CVE-2021-35550 (SUSE): 5.9 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:H/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:N/A:N CVE-2021-35556 (NVD) : 5.3 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:L CVE-2021-35556 (SUSE): 5.3 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:L CVE-2021-35559 (NVD) : 5.3 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:L CVE-2021-35561 (NVD) : 5.3 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:L CVE-2021-35561 (SUSE): 5.3 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:L CVE-2021-35564 (NVD) : 5.3 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:L/A:N CVE-2021-35564 (SUSE): 5.3 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:L/A:N CVE-2021-35565 (NVD) : 5.3 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:L CVE-2021-35565 (SUSE): 5.3 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:L CVE-2021-35567 (NVD) : 6.8 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:R/S:C/C:H/I:N/A:N CVE-2021-35578 (NVD) : 5.3 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:L CVE-2021-35578 (SUSE): 5.3 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:L CVE-2021-35586 (NVD) : 5.3C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:L CVE-2021-35586 (SUSE): 5.3 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:L CVE-2021-35603 (NVD) : 3.7 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:H/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:N/A:N CVE-2021-35603 (SUSE): 3.7 C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:H/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:N/A:N Affected Products: SUSE Linux Enterprise Server 12-SP5 ______________________________________________________________________________ An update that fixes 10 vulnerabilities is now available. Description: This update for java-11-openjdk fixes the following issues: Update to 11.0.13+8 (October 2021 CPU) - CVE-2021-35550, bsc#1191901: Update the default enabled cipher suites preference - CVE-2021-35565, bsc#1191909: com.sun.net.HttpsServer spins on TLS session close - CVE-2021-35556, bsc#1191910: Richer Text Editors - CVE-2021-35559, bsc#1191911: Enhanced style for RTF kit - CVE-2021-35561, bsc#1191912: Better hashing support - CVE-2021-35564, bsc#1191913: Improve Keystore integrity - CVE-2021-35567, bsc#1191903: More Constrained Delegation - CVE-2021-35578, bsc#1191904: Improve TLS client handshaking - CVE-2021-35586, bsc#1191914: Better BMP support - CVE-2021-35603, bsc#1191906: Better session identification - Improve Stream handling for SSL - Improve requests of certificates - Correct certificate requests - Enhance DTLS client handshake Patch Instructions: To install this SUSE Security Update use the SUSE recommended installation methods like YaST online_update or "zypper patch".
